Overview
Kima is a pescatarian Grecophile’s delight! A fish counter displays the daily catch, perhaps wild red mullet, from which tailor-made meals are fashioned using all cuts in the ‘fin-to-gill’ genre. Dishes such as octopus xidato or sea bream shank fricassée are delivered with style, simplicity, finesse and flavour, and the intimate, relaxed modern space comes with bags of Greek hospitality.

Our inspector loves...
  Greek pescatarian restaurant - Opposite its flagship sibling OPSO, Kima deals in the Greek flavours of the sea
  Focal-point fish counter - Displaying the daily catch from which customised meals are created using all the cuts
  Vibe and Service - Intimate, light, relaxed modern space, offering spot-on service and Greek hospitality
  Lunchtime value - Fixed-price great value lunchtime 'fin-to-gill menu' using the fish of the day
  Notable Greek wines - Like its flagship sibling OPSO opposite, Kima offers a corking list of Greek wines
